Output 66e2052030b81fe8027ed9a4a42f1e59da082a32b5f0ce124650c2e5744be443:12
- value
- 2893500
- script pubkey
- OP_0 OP_PUSHBYTES_20 9059a73d2313fcc4897d6be6e001fe683f76fc30
- address
- bc1qjpv6w0frz07vfztad0nwqq07dqlhdlpsf83r3s
- transaction
- 66e2052030b81fe8027ed9a4a42f1e59da082a32b5f0ce124650c2e5744be443